Overview

Why this framework exists

The Athletic Ability Framework emphasizes the importance of understanding individual genetic propensities and athletic abilities to optimize training and reduce injury risk. By recognizing the unique characteristics of each person, including their body type, muscle tone, and flexibility, individuals can tailor their training to their strengths and weaknesses, ultimately achieving better results and minimizing the risk of injury.

Core principles

3 total
  1. Understand your individual genetic propensities and athletic abilities
  2. Train to your strengths, not your weaknesses
  3. Avoid overtraining and undertraining by tailoring your approach to your unique characteristics

Steps

4 steps
  1. Assess your athletic ability
    Evaluate your body type, muscle tone, and flexibility to understand your strengths and weaknesses. Consider factors such as your ectomorphic, mesomorphic, or endomorphic tendencies, as well as your muscle imbalances and movement patterns.
    Pro tipWork with a qualified coach or trainer to help you assess your athletic ability and develop a personalized training plan.
    WarningAvoid comparing yourself to others or trying to fit into a predetermined mold; instead, focus on understanding and working with your unique characteristics.
  2. Develop a personalized training plan
    Based on your assessment, create a training plan that plays to your strengths and addresses your weaknesses. This may involve focusing on specific exercises, drills, or activities that help you build on your strengths and improve your weaknesses.
    Pro tipIncorporate a variety of training methods, including strength training, flexibility exercises, and cardiovascular activities, to create a well-rounded and balanced approach.
    WarningBe cautious not to overdo it; gradual progress and consistency are key to avoiding injury and achieving long-term success.
  3. Monitor and adjust your training
    Regularly monitor your progress and adjust your training plan as needed. This may involve modifying your exercises, intensity, or volume based on your body's response and your goals.
    Pro tipListen to your body and take regular breaks to avoid burnout and prevent overtraining.
    WarningDon't be afraid to seek help if you're unsure about how to adjust your training or if you're experiencing persistent pain or discomfort.
  4. Incorporate injury prevention strategies
    In addition to training, incorporate strategies to prevent injury, such as proper warm-up and cool-down routines, stretching, and foam rolling. This can help reduce your risk of injury and improve your overall resilience.
    Pro tipMake injury prevention a habit by incorporating it into your daily routine, such as before and after training sessions.
    WarningDon't neglect injury prevention; it's a critical component of long-term success and can help you avoid costly setbacks.

Common mistakes

3 traps
Overtraining
Overtraining can lead to injury, burnout, and decreased performance. Avoid pushing yourself too hard, and prioritize gradual progress and consistency.
Undertraining
Undertraining can lead to stagnation and decreased performance. Avoid being too easy on yourself, and challenge yourself to progress and improve.
Ignoring individual differences
Ignoring individual differences can lead to injury and decreased performance. Avoid comparing yourself to others or trying to fit into a predetermined mold; instead, focus on understanding and working with your unique characteristics.

Origin story

How this framework came to be

Dr. Stuart McGill developed this framework through his work with elite athletes, recognizing that each individual has a unique set of characteristics that influence their athletic ability and injury risk. By applying this framework, individuals can take a more informed and effective approach to training, avoiding the pitfalls of overtraining and undertraining.
